شبکه بولتزمن ایرانی

مشاوره و ارائه پروژه‌های شبکه بولتزمن

شبکه بولتزمن ایرانی

مشاوره و ارائه پروژه‌های شبکه بولتزمن

شبکه بولتزمن ایرانی

روش شبکه بولتزمن یک روش دینامیک سیالات محاسباتی است که در سالهای اخیر توجه بسیاری از پژوهشگران داخلی را به خود جلب نموده است. تا حدی که در این مدت پایان نامه و مقالات متعدی بر مبنای این روش محاسباتی منتشر شده و در حال انجام می‌باشد. ولی با توجه به ارتباط محدود میان دانشجویان مهندسی مکانیک سیالات و تبدیل انرژی، اخیراً کیفیت مقالات و پایان نامه‌های دانشجویی در زمینه‌ی روش شبکه بولتزمن به شدت پایین آمده و به نوعی حالت سکون رسیده است. زیرا هر یک از دانشجویان برای انجام پروژه خود از صفر شروع کرده و با توجه به زمان محدودی که دارد، نمی تواند کار مطلوب و درخور توجهی را به سرانجام برساند. گردانندگان این وبلاگ امیدوارند که با ارائه تجربیات و کدهای شخصی خود به دیگر دانشجویان از اتلاف وقت آن‌ها جلوگیری کرده و تأثیری هر چند ناچیز در جهت رشد کیفیت پایان نامه ها و مقالات روش شبکه بولتزمن داشته باشند.

بایگانی

با گذشت نزدیک به یک سال از راه اندازی وبلاگ شبکه بولتزمن، مطالبی مقدماتی و بعضاً کدهای ساده ای در این وبلاگ قرار گرفت. که با توجه به تخصصی بودن موضوع وبلاگ، بازخورد آنها برای بنده رضایت بخش بود.

به همین دلیل برای تشکر از بازدید کنندگان این وبلاگ و همچنین خدمت به جامعه علمی کشور، قصد داریم که در این تاپیک فایل های اجرایی کدهای به نسبت پیشرفته تری را  به همراه راهنمای آنها و به صورت رایگان قرار دهیم.

در ادامه مطلب عنوان و لینک دانلود فایل های اجرایی(فرترن 95) کدهای مذکور قرار داده شده است.

در واقع مسئله جریان در یک محفظه مستطیلی با درپوش متحرک یکی از بهترین مسائل برای اعتبارسنجی کدهای عددی می‌باشد. چونکه هم مقالات معتبر فراوانی در این زمینه وجود دارد و هم اینکه به دلیل وجود گردابه‌های خاص در این مسئله، مقایسه مراکز این گردابه‌ها با حل‌های مرجع یک معیار عالی در سنجش دقت کد عددی می‌باشد. در اینجا یک کد بسیار دقیق و با کیفیت برای استفاده محققین گرامی ارائه شده است. که می‌توانید آن را مبنای کار عددی خود قرار داده و توسعه دهید.

در ادامه مطلب یک برنامه مدلسازی جابجایی طبیعی در یک محفظه مستطیلی به زبان فرترن در دو ورژن فرترن 90 و 95 برای استفاده مبتدیان کار با روش شبکه بولتزمن قرار داده شده است. این برنامه در نهایت دقت و با رعایت استاندارهای بسیار سطح بالا تهیه شده است.

                                                                 

در سال‏های اخیر ارزیابی میزان افزایش انتقال حرارت در صورت استفاده از نانوسیالات در سیستم‏های حرارتی، مرکز توجه بسیاری از محققین قرار گرفته است.چرا که پیشرفت‏های جدید در ساخت نانوسیالات مرغوب (100-1 نانومتر) باعث گرایش صنایع به استفاده از نانوسیالات با ضریب رسانش حرارتی و ضریب انتقال حرارت جابجایی بالاتر نسبت به سیالات خالص شده‌‏است. در این نگاره به ارائه خلاصه‌‏ای از مطالعات عددی انجام شده در زمینه نانوسیالات که شامل انواع روشهای عددی تا جدیدترین آنها که روش شبکه بولتزمن است می‌‏پردازیم. روشهای عددی بکار گرفته شده برای مدلسازی نانوسیالات به دو گروه عمده دو-فازی و تک-فازی تقسیم می‏شوند و تفاوت آنها در مرتبه دقت، هزینه محاسباتی و  سطح دشواری کدنویسی است. ولی نتایج حاصل از تمام این روش‏ها بسته به نیاز و امکانات و مهارت کاربر تطابق قابل قبولی با نتایج آزمایشگاهی نشان داده‌‏اند. در ادامه مطلب، ورژن رایگان این سمینار قرار داده شده است.

در سالهای اخیر توانایی روش شبکه بولتزمن در مدلسازی جریان­های پیچیده مانند جریان­های دوفازی، جریان در محیط متخلخل و همینطور جریان سیالات غیرنیوتنی به اثبات رسیده‌­است. این روش در عین سادگی دقت بسیار بالایی دارد و در مرکز توجه بسیاری از دانشمندان قرار گرفته‌­است. در این مقاله ضمن معرفی این روش، به مرور برخی از مقالات معتبر در زمینه مدلسازی انواع سیالات غیرنیونتی به روش شبکه بولتزمن پرداخته شده‌است. در ادامه مطلب می‌توانید ورژن رایگان این سمینار را دانلود نمایید.

مسئله جابجایی طبیعی درون محفظه مستطیلی یکی از پایه‌ای ترین مسائل انتقال حرارت مهندسی می‌باشد. به همین دلیل در این زمینه مقالات بسیار متنوعی با انواع روش‌های تحلیلی، آزمایشگاهی و عددی منتشر شده است. حتی با وجود سادگی هندسه و تعدد مقالات موجود، هنوز هم مقالات جدیدی با دیدگاه‌های متفاوت در این زمینه منتشر می‌شود.


در ادامه مطلب یک برنامه مدلسازی جابجایی طبیعی در یک محفظه مستطیلی به زبان فرترن در دو ورژن فرترن 90 و 95 برای استفاده مبتدیان کار با روش شبکه بولتزمن قرار داده شده است. این برنامه در نهایت دقت و با رعایت استاندارهای بسیار سطح بالا تهیه شده است.

                                                                 

اگر قصد یادگیری و یا شروع یک پروژه برنامه‌نویسی به زبان فرترن را دارید؛ حتماً چند روزی است که پیدا کردن یک منبع مناسب ذهن شما را درگیر کرده است. حتی شاید کلی برای خرید یک گتاب چند صد صفحه‌ای هزینه کرده باشید و نه وقت مطالعه آن را دارید و نه امیدی دارید که نتیجه بگیرید. در ادامه مطلب، یک منبع ایده‌آل در اخیار شما گذاشته شده است.

مثل هر زبان برنامه نویسی دیگر، فرترن هم دارای ورژن‌های مختلف و با طیف بزرگی از انواع حجم‌ها دارد. تمام این ورژن‌ها در دو عنوان اصلی فرترن 90 و فرترن 95 قرار می‌گیرند. در ادامه مطلب، از هرکدام یک کاملا تست شده برای دانلود قرار داده شده است.

واضح است که قبل از شروع هر پروژه شبکه بولتزمن، لازم است است که بر برنامه نویسی تسلط کافی داشته باشیم. ولی برای شروع آن 2 سوال اساسی به صورت زیر مطرح می‌شود:

1- کدام زبان برنامه‌نویسی؟

2- کدام مرجع یادگیری زبان برنامه‌نویسی؟

همانطور که در تاریخچه شبکه بولتزمن اشاره شد؛ مبانی پایه‌ای روش شبکه بولتزمن بسیار پیچیده می‌باشد. در ابتدای امر نیز ارائه و گسترش مبانی این روش توسط دانشمندان علم فیزیک و آمار صورت گرفته است. به همین دلیل حداقل کسی از دانشجویان کارشناسی و کارشناسی ارشد مهندسی مکانیک و... انتظار تسلط کامل بر مبانی شبکه بولتزمن را ندارد. در ادامه مطلب برخی از منبع برتر یادگیری شبکه بولتزمن به همراه لینک دانلود و برخی توضیحات آورده شده است.

روش شبکه بولتزمن در واقع یک روش محاسباتی است که بر پایه‏‌ی تئوری انرژی جنبشی استوار بوده و ابتدا برای شبیه‌سازی جریان سیال مورد استفاده قرار گرفته است. در واقع انواع مدل‏‏‌های این روش محاسباتی از تکنیک روش شبکه سلول‌های گازی(LGCA) الگوبرداری شده‌اند. ایده اصلی روش LGCA این است که تعاریف متفاوت در سطح میکروسکوپی می‌‏توانند در سطوح ماکروسکوپی نیز مورد استفاده قرار گیرند. با استفاده از‏ یک مدل سلولی ساده که تنها از قوانین بقای جرم و اندازه حرکت در سطح میکروسکوپی پیروی می‌‏کند و با قرار دادن آن در‏ یک شبکه مناسب، می‌­توان نشان داد که با استفاده از تحلیل چند سطحی چپمن-انسکوگ، معادلات ناویر استوکس مربوط به سیال با تراکم‌پذیری کم از یک شبکه‌‏ی میکروسکوپی به دست می‌آیند.